Rapid-hardening inorganic filling support material for mine and using method of support material
The invention discloses a rapid-hardening inorganic filling support material for mine. The support material consists of a component A and a component B, wherein the component A com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 93-97 parts of sulphoaluminate cement clinker, 2-5 parts of an XWZ-A type compound admixture, 0.01-0.1 part of an air entraining agent, 0.0-0.05 part of an air entraining admixture, 0.2-1.0 part of a foam stabilizer and 0.25-2 parts of fibers; and the component B com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 75-88 parts of gypsum, 10-25 parts of lime, 2-5 parts of an XWZ-A type compound admixture, 0.01-0.1 part of an air entraining agent, 0.0-0.05 part of an air entraining admixture, 0.2-1.0 part of a foam stabilizer and 0.25-2 parts of fibers. The prepared filling support material disclosed by the invention has the characteristics of quick setting property, lightweight, rapid hardening property, early strength, high compressibility, high residual strength, good gas tightness and the like, and is particularly suitable for the mine filling support aspect.
